Infinity Turbine and Salgenx Announce Groundbreaking Cluster Mesh Power Generation System for Data Center Efficiency and Grid-Scale Saltwater Battery Storage

MADISON, WI, UNITED STATES, September 25, 2024 /EINPresswire.com/ -- Infinity Turbine LLC and Salgenx Saltwater Battery are proud to unveil their cutting-edge Cluster Mesh Power Generation System, a revolutionary technology designed to maximize the utilization of thermal energy while providing substantial savings for data centers and introducing a highly efficient energy storage solution.

With a Coefficient of Performance (COP) of 9, this innovative system not only generates power from data center waste heat, but also produces cooling as a byproduct of the pressure drop from its supercritical CO2 turbines.

This advanced system is poised to transform energy-intensive sectors such as data centers, thermal energy storage, and large-scale battery solutions by integrating renewable energy into everyday operations.

The unique ability to harness thermal energy for both cooling and power generation positions Infinity Turbine and Salgenx at the forefront of sustainable energy technology.

Data Center Savings and Efficiency

Data centers represent some of the largest consumers of energy in the modern world, with significant amounts of power dedicated to maintaining optimal operating temperatures for servers and GPUs. Traditional cooling methods require immense energy inputs, adding operational costs and environmental impact. The waste heat then has to be vented to the air, or cooled by a chiller.

The Cluster Mesh Power Generation system solves this challenge by taking the waste heat and utilizing supercritical CO2 in a closed-loop cycle. When thermal energy drives the supercritical CO2 through the system, the pressure drop utilized by the turbines not only generates electricity but also produces a cooling effect as a secondary benefit.

This cooling significantly reduces the need for traditional air conditioning or liquid cooling systems in data centers.

This dual-function technology simultaneously reduces the energy costs of cooling while generating power from waste heat, making it a perfect fit for the demands of high-performance data centers. The heat pump portion of the turbine may reach a COP (Coefficient of Performance) of 9.

Salgenx Saltwater Battery for Grid-Scale and Thermal Energy Storage

Beyond data centers, the Cluster Mesh Power Generation system integrates seamlessly with Salgenx Saltwater Batteries to provide grid-scale storage solutions. This innovative system can be used to store up to 3,000 kWh per module of electrical power, and thermal energy during off-peak hours, allowing operators to charge the saltwater batteries with excess power and then discharge the stored energy when needed.

The saltwater storage system can also be utilized for thermal energy storage (TESS), capturing and holding excess thermal energy to be released during peak demand or used for grid stabilization. By enabling the storage of thermal energy, this combined system ensures efficient energy management across various sectors, from data centers to renewable energy grids.

For USA licensed manufacturers of this system, there are a $35/kWh tax credit for the battery portion, and other credits for the thermal energy storage.
